利用 AWS SDK 提升云服务开发效率
在当今数字化时代,云计算技术的广泛应用成为企业发展的关键,而亚马逊网络服务(AWS)作为全球领先的云服务提供商,其提供的强大功能和丰富的工具深受开发者喜爱,AWS SDK 更是开发者们在 AWS 平台上进行开发的得力助手。
AWS SDK 是一组软件开发工具包,旨在简化与 AWS 服务的交互,它为开发者提供了统一的编程接口,使得开发者可以使用熟悉的编程语言(如 Java、Python、JavaScript 等)来访问 AWS 平台上的各种服务,如存储、计算、数据库、网络等,通过使用 AWS SDK,开发者可以大大提高开发效率,减少代码重复,并且能够更好地利用 AWS 提供的各种优势。
使用 AWS SDK 具有诸多好处,它提供了高度的可定制性和灵活性,开发者可以根据自己的需求选择合适的服务和功能,并进行个性化的配置和扩展,AWS SDK 经过了充分的测试和优化,具有较高的稳定性和可靠性,能够保证在各种复杂环境下的正常运行,AWS 不断更新和改进 SDK,为开发者提供最新的功能和特性,使其始终保持竞争力。
在实际开发中,AWS SDK 的应用非常广泛,在构建云存储应用时,开发者可以使用 AWS SDK 来轻松地与 AWS S3 服务进行交互,实现文件的上传、下载、存储和管理,对于计算密集型应用,AWS SDK 可以帮助开发者利用 AWS 的云计算资源进行高效的计算任务处理,AWS SDK 还提供了身份验证和授权机制,确保开发者的应用在安全的环境下运行。
为了更好地利用 AWS SDK,开发者需要掌握一些基本的开发技巧,要熟悉 AWS 服务的架构和原理,了解各个服务之间的关系和交互方式,要熟练掌握所选编程语言的 AWS SDK 相关库的使用方法,包括如何进行连接、配置参数、调用服务方法等,还需要关注 AWS 的文档和示例代码,通过学习和实践不断提高自己的开发能力。
AWS SDK 是开发者在 AWS 平台上进行开发的重要工具,它能够提升开发效率,简化开发流程,让开发者更好地利用 AWS 提供的丰富资源和强大功能,掌握 AWS SDK 的使用技巧,对于开发者在云计算领域的发展具有重要意义,无论是构建新的应用还是对现有系统进行云化改造,AWS SDK 都将成为开发者的得力助手,助力实现数字化转型的目标。